What is a Low Carb Low Fat 1200 Calorie Diet Plan?
A low carb low fat 1200 calorie diet plan involves reducing the
consumption of carbohydrates and fats and limiting calorie intake to
1200 per day. This diet plan aims to create a calorie deficit,
which forces the body to burn stored fat for energy. The diet
emphasizes the consumption of foods that are high in protein, fiber,
vitamins, and minerals while limiting foods that are high in
carbohydrates, fats, and calories.

Drawbacks of a Low Carb Low Fat 1200 Calorie Diet Plan
- Nutrient deficiencies: This diet plan can lead to nutrient deficiencies if it is not followed correctly. It is important to make sure that the diet includes a variety of nutrient-rich foods.
- Hunger pangs: Consuming only 1200 calories a day can lead to hunger pangs, which can be difficult to manage.
- Unsustainable: This diet plan can be difficult to sustain in the
long run, as it can be restrictive and may lead to boredom with food
options.

Sample Low Carb Low Fat 1200 Calorie Diet Plan
Here is a sample low carb low fat 1200 calorie diet plan:
- Breakfast: Scrambled eggs with spinach and mushrooms (200 calories)
- Snack: Apple slices with almond butter (150 calories)
- Lunch: Grilled chicken breast with roasted vegetables (300 calories)
- Snack: Greek yogurt with mixed berries (100 calories)
- Dinner: Baked salmon with asparagus and brown rice (350 calories)
- Snack: Carrot sticks with hummus (100 calories)
